Hi, I bought my first Jaguar last year and it has been a joy. I am sure it won't be my last. It is a 1996 lwb 4 litre sovereign metallic black with light grey leather. It had been converted to lpg a few months before I bought it and it runs very well on gas and petrol. I have replaced the diff, slight whine on overrun, and rear shocks, bottom bush worn, I now have to sort out the heated front seats both switchs light up but both seats not heating, faulty relay? and the headlining is starting to sag, what glue to use?
I look forward to getting some good advice.
